class DarwinException(Exception):
"""
Generic Darwin exception.
Used to differentiate from errors that originate in our code, and those that originate in
third-party libraries.
Extends `Exception` and adds a `parent_exception` field to store the original exception.
Also has a `combined_exceptions` field to store a list of exceptions that were combined into
"""
parent_exception: Optional[Exception] = None
combined_exceptions: Optional[List[Exception]] = None
def __init__(self, *args: UnknownType, **kwargs: KeyValuePairDict) -> None:
super().__init__(*args, **kwargs)
[docs]
@classmethod
def from_exception(cls, exc: Exception) -> "DarwinException":
"""
Creates a new exception from an existing exception.
Parameters
----------
exc: Exception
The existing exception.
Returns
-------
DarwinException
The new exception.
"""
instance = cls(str(exc))
instance.parent_exception = exc
return instance
def __str__(self) -> str:
output_string = f"{self.__class__.__name__}: {super().__str__()}\n"
if self.parent_exception:
output_string += f"Parent exception: {self.parent_exception}\n"
if self.combined_exceptions:
output_string += f"Combined exceptions: {self.combined_exceptions}\n"
return output_string
def __repr__(self) -> str:
return super().__repr__()
[docs]
@classmethod
def from_multiple_exceptions(
cls,
exceptions: List[Exception],
echo: bool = False,
console: Optional[Console] = None,
) -> "DarwinException":
"""
Creates a new exception from a list of exceptions.
Parameters
----------
exceptions: List[Exception]
The list of exceptions.
Returns
-------
DarwinException
The new exception.
"""
instance = cls(
f"Multiple errors occurred while exporting: {', '.join([str(e) for e in exceptions])}",
)
instance.combined_exceptions = exceptions
if echo:
if console:
console.log(["Multiple Exceptions occurred.", *exceptions])
else:
for exc in exceptions:
pprint(exc)
return instance
